Gladstone Government Defeated.

A MAJORITY OF 121 AGAINffID TV/ THEM.

, A DISSOLUTION PROR^BLR ** [bEUTBBS' TELEG]*AMB.jI, ; j;^^ 1 ■ ' Lonbok,, dpune i£ The debate on the financial proposals of the Government was Drought .ibTil^ close at am early hour this morning? * when a division was ikltjav/^f^^U^ j result that the budget was Rejected by pi a majority of twelve, not^tbj£fandin£ >"■ that Mr Gladstone aMjounced that the : Government would make its acceptance a Cabinet question. An amendment^ proposed by Sir Michael Hicks-Beach, condemning the proposed increase in duty on beer and spirits, was then carried. In consequence of the advert vote, the resignation hi Ministers ; iH expected. •■ ' . m \
